1. Minimalist Chic

Minimalist design is all about simplicity and functionality. This design style focuses on clean lines, neutral colors, and the use of natural materials. In a minimalist chic bedroom, the color palette is usually limited to black, white, and shades of gray. However, you can also incorporate natural materials such as wood and stone to add warmth and texture to the space.

When designing a minimalist chic bedroom, it’s important to focus on the basics. Keep furniture and decor to a minimum, and only include items that serve a functional purpose. Choose simple bedding and curtains in neutral colors, and use artwork sparingly. This will allow the natural materials and clean lines to take center stage.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ate plants or artwork with bold colors. However, make sure to keep these accents minimal to maintain the minimalist style.

2. Scandinavian-inspired

Scandinavian design is known for its simplicity, functionality, and focus on natural materials. This design style features a light and airy color palette that consists of white, light gray, and pastel shades. The use of wood and other natural materials is also a hallmark of Scandinavian design.

In a Scandinavian-inspired bedroom, the focus should be on functionality and comfort. The furniture should be simple and functional, and the bedding should be soft and cozy. You can add warmth and texture to the space by incorporating natural materials such as a woolen rug or a wooden headboard.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can use bold artwork or textiles in shades of blue, green, or pink. However, make sure to keep the accents minimal to maintain the simplicity of the design.

3. Rustic Charm

Rustic bedroom design is all about creating a warm and inviting atmosphere. This design style features earthy colors and natural materials such as wood and stone. In a rustic charm bedroom, the color palette is usually limited to shades of brown, beige, and gray.

To create a rustic charm bedroom, start by incorporating natural materials such as a wooden headboard or a stone accent wall. Choose bedding and curtains in neutral colors, and add warmth to the space with a cozy throw blanket or rug.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ate textiles or artwork in shades of green or blue. However, make sure to keep the accents minimal to maintain the rustic charm of the space.

4. Industrial Elegance

Industrial design is all about creating a raw and edgy atmosphere. This design style features exposed brick, metal, and other raw materials. In an industrial elegance bedroom, the color palette is usually limited to neutral colors such as black, gray, and brown.

To create an industrial elegance bedroom, start by incorporating raw materials such as an exposed brick wall or a metal bedframe. Choose bedding and curtains in neutral colors, and add warmth to the space with a cozy throw blanket or rug.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ate bold accents such as a bright yellow throw pillow or a red accent wall. However, make sure to keep the accents minimal to maintain the industrial elegance of the space.

5. Modern Farmhouse

Modern farmhouse design combines the warmth of traditional farmhouse design with the clean lines and simplicity of modern design. This design style features a neutral color palette, natural materials, and vintage-inspired accents.

To create a modern farmhouse bedroom, start by incorporating natural materials such as a wooden headboard or a woven rug. Choose bedding and curtains in neutral colors, and add warmth to the space with a cozy throw blanket or pillows with vintage-inspired prints.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ate accents in shades of blue, green, or red. However, make sure to keep the accents minimal to maintain the simplicity of the design.

6. Coastal-inspired

Coastal design is all about creating a relaxed and soothing atmosphere. This design style features a light and airy color palette that consists of white, blue, and sandy beige. The use of natural materials such as rattan and driftwood is also a hallmark of coastal design.

To create a coastal-inspired bedroom, start by incorporating natural materials such as a woven rattan headboard or a driftwood mirror. Choose bedding and curtains in shades of white, blue, or sandy beige, and add warmth to the space with a cozy throw blanket or pillows in shades of blue.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ate accents in shades of coral or turquoise. However, make sure to keep the accents minimal to maintain the relaxed and soothing atmosphere of the space.

7. Urban Loft

Urban loft design is all about creating a chic and edgy atmosphere. This design style features a neutral color palette, exposed brick, and industrial-inspired accents.

To create an urban loft bedroom, start by incorporating raw materials such as an exposed brick wall or a metal bedframe. Choose bedding and curtains in neutral colors, and add warmth to the space with a cozy throw blanket or rug.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ate bold accents such as a bright orange throw pillow or a green accent wall. However, make sure to keep the accents minimal to maintain the edgy and chic atmosphere of the space.

8. Art Deco-inspired

Art Deco design is all about creating a glamorous and luxurious atmosphere. This design style features a neutral color palette, geometric shapes, and metallic accents.

To create an Art Deco-inspired bedroom, start by incorporating geometric shapes such as a hexagonal headboard or a diamond-patterned rug. Choose bedding and curtains in neutral colors, and add warmth to the space with a plush fur throw blanket or pillows.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ate accents in shades of gold or silver. However, make sure to keep the accents minimal to maintain the glamorous and luxurious atmosphere of the space.

9. Japanese-inspired

Japanese design is all about creating a calm and serene atmosphere. This design style features a neutral color palette, natural materials, and minimalistic decor.

To create a Japanese-inspired bedroom, start by incorporating natural materials such as a bamboo headboard or a shoji screen. Choose bedding and curtains in neutral colors, and add warmth to the space with a cozy tatami mat or a woven rug.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ate accents in shades of red or green. However, make sure to keep the accents minimal to maintain the calm and serene atmosphere of the space.

10. Bohemian-inspired

Bohemian design is all about creating a cozy and eclectic atmosphere. This design style features a mix of patterns, textures, and colors. In a Bohemian-inspired bedroom, start by incorporating a variety of textures such as a macrame wall hanging, a woven rug, and a velvet throw pillow. Choose bedding and curtains in a mix of patterns and colors, and add warmth to the space with a cozy throw blanket.

To add a pop of color to the space, you can incorporate accents in shades of pink, purple, or turquoise. However, make sure to keep the accents balanced to maintain the eclectic atmosphere of the space.
